Output 954152af3dcb5e71b76f406d2321f0a0586b2545328efe692dd0cd1ec50f3c0e:0

value
26904881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13978753d6d543de9a8a671617d01d54032431af OP_EQUAL
address
33UcHahYiZuannetADQ3WJouKzyAdhP6Z7
transaction
954152af3dcb5e71b76f406d2321f0a0586b2545328efe692dd0cd1ec50f3c0e
spent
true